Evaluation of immune cellular enzymes, oxidative and nitrosative Stress in Saudi Patients with Cutaneous Leishmaniasis in Al-AHssa, before and after treatment

<title>Abstract</title> <p><bold>Background</bold> Macrophages, within which Leishmania sp. replicate, generate large amounts of reactive oxygen species (ROS) and reactive nitrogen species (RNS) to kill these parasites. <bold>Methods </bold>The aim of the present study was to assess oxidative, nitrosative stresses, and some immune enzymes in blood of cutaneous leishmaniasis (CL) patients before and after treatmen...
